#f07c1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f07c1c is composed of 94.1% red, 48.6%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.3% magenta, 88.3%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 27.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 52.5%. #f07c1c color hex could be obtained by blending #fff838 with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

● #f07c1c color description : Vivid orange.
#f07c1c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f07c1c has RGB values of R:240, G:124,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.88,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15760412.

Shades and Tints of #f07c1c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0601 is the darkest color, while #fffb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f07c1c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8682 is the less saturated color, while #f97b13 is the most saturated one.
